Course Overview

The Administering System Center Configuration Manager course is designed to provide IT professionals with the knowledge and skills to effectively use Microsoft’s Configuration Manager to manage a network of computers. This comprehensive course covers a wide range of topics, including system architecture, client deployment, inventory management, application deployment, software updates, Endpoint Protection, compliance management, operating system deployment, and site maintenance. Learners will gain hands-on experience through labs, where they will explore tools, configure services, deploy applications, manage software updates, and more. This course is crucial for those looking to leverage Configuration Manager for enterprise management solutions and to ensure the security and compliance of their IT environment. By mastering these skills, IT professionals can streamline their management operations, effectively deploy and manage applications, maintain up-to-date systems, and safeguard their networks against threats.

Learning Objectives

  • Describe the features of Configuration Manager and Intune, and explain how you can use these features to manage PCs and mobile devices in an enterprise environment. Analyze data by using queries and reports.
  • Prepare a management infrastructure, including configuring boundaries, boundary groups, resource discovery, and integrating mobile-device management with Microsoft Exchange Server.
  • Deploy and manage the Configuration Manager client.
  • Configure, manage, and monitor hardware and software inventory as well as use Asset Intelligence and software metering.
  • Identify and configure the most appropriate method to distribute and manage content used for deployments.
  • Distribute, deploy, and monitor applications for managed users and systems.
  • Maintain software updates for PCs that Configuration Manager administers.
  • Manage configuration items, baselines, and profiles to assess and configure compliance settings and data access for users and devices.
  • Configure an operating system deployment strategy by using Configuration Manager.
  • Manage and maintain a Configuration Manager site.

Course Prerequisites

To ensure a successful learning experience in the Administering System Center Configuration Manager 2016 course, participants should have the following minimum prerequisites:

  • Basic understanding of networking fundamentals, including TCP/IP and Domain Name System (DNS).
  • Familiarity with Active Directory Domain Services (AD DS) principles and management.
  • Experience with Windows Server administration, maintenance, and troubleshooting.
  • Knowledge of Windows client operating system fundamentals (Windows 10 or later).
  • Basic understanding of the concepts of Public Key Infrastructure (PKI) security.
  • Experience with Windows PowerShell and command-line interface scripting.

Target Audiance

  • This course is for experienced information technology (IT) professionals who deploy, manage, and maintain PCs, devices, and applications across medium, large, and enterprise organizations.

Course Content

  • Overview of systems management by using enterprise management solutions
  • Overview of the Configuration Manager architecture
  • Overview of the Configuration Manager administrative tools
  • Tools for monitoring and troubleshooting a Configuration Manager site

  • Introduction to queries
  • Configuring Microsoft SQL Server Reporting Services (SSRS)
  • Analyzing the real-time state of devices by using CMPivot

  • Configuring site boundaries and boundary groups
  • Configuring resource discovery
  • Organizing resources using devices and user collections

  • Overview of the Configuration Manager client
  • Deploying the Configuration Manager client
  • Configuring and monitoring client status
  • Managing client settings and performing management operations

  • Overview of inventory collection
  • Configuring hardware and software inventory
  • Managing inventory collection
  • Configuring software metering
  • Configuring and managing Asset Intelligence

  • Preparing the infrastructure for content management
  • Distributing and managing content on distribution points

  • Overview of application management
  • Creating applications
  • Deploying applications
  • Managing applications
  • Deploying virtual applications by using System Center Configuration Manager (Optional)
  • Deploying and managing Windows Store apps

  • The software updates process
  • Preparing a Configuration Manager site for software updates
  • Managing software updates
  • Configuring automatic deployment rules
  • Monitoring and troubleshooting software updates
  • Enabling third-party updates

  • Overview of Endpoint Protection in Configuration Manager
  • Configuring, deploying, and monitoring Endpoint Protection policies
  • Configuring and deploying advanced threat policies

  • Overview of compliance settings
  • Configuring compliance settings
  • Viewing compliance results
  • Managing resource and data access

  • An overview of operating system deployment
  • Preparing a site for operating system deployment
  • Deploying an operating system
  • Managing Windows as a service

  • Configuring role-based administration
  • Configuring Remote Tools
  • Overview of Configuration Manager site maintenance and Management Insights
  • Backing up and recovering a Configuration Manager site
  • Updating the Configuration Manager Infrastructure
